开发场景:抖音seo,短视频seo,抖音矩阵,短视频矩阵源码开源
一、 短视频矩阵源码需要掌握以下技术:
1. 视频编码技术
短视频矩阵系统利用视频编码技术,将视频文件进行压缩和解压缩,实现了高质量视频的传输和播放,同时,短视频矩阵技术采用的编码器也才用了矩阵的技术,如X264,h.264等,这些编码器在压缩视频时能保证视频高质量和高效率。
2. 音视频处理技术
短视频矩阵系统支持音视频技术处理,如音效,音频,文字转语音生成等,这些技术可以让用户在上传视频素材的同时结合视频素材生成新的原创视频,使短视频更具有吸引力,同时在处理的过程中,也用到了转场,滤镜等特效以增加视频的质量。
3. 服务器集群处理
短视频矩阵对于服务器的要求比较高,采用的多是服务器集群处理,这个技术可以将多台服务器链接起来,行程一个大型的计算机群体,以确保服务器的负载均衡,提高系统的稳定性和可靠性。
二、 产品构建上,独特规划
1. 接入抖音小程序,利用抖音小程序特有流量入口(直播挂载,短视频挂载,关键词搜索等)进行私域转化。
2. 支持一码多扫,摒弃了原有的一个账号扫描一下的繁琐流程,支持发送固定二维码,员工在随时随地可进行扫码授权。
3. 粉丝画像 ,包括粉丝来源,粉丝分布等数据分析
4. 多投放入口,支持将其他批量制作好的视频批量导入,批量分发
5. 账号分组管理,支持对不同类型账号做分组管理,账号授权自动归入所属分组。
6. 产品开源,多合作模式
三、 技术开发
- 开发语言:PHP
- 开发环境:linux
- 开放框架:mvc
- 是否开放:开源
代码展示
$row = self::$register_model->getRow(self::$sr_where);
if ($row) {
// $row['status'] = 3;
$thirdInfo = $this->getCateById($row['sr_category_code']);
$secondInfo = $this->getCateById($thirdInfo->Spid);
$firstInfo = $this->getCateById($thirdInfo->Fpid);
$row['cate_name'] = $firstInfo->Name . '-->' . $secondInfo->Name . '-->' . $thirdInfo->Name;
$row['sr_registered_province_name'] = $this->area_obj->findCityNameByCode($row['sr_registered_province_code'])[0]['aa_name'];
$row['sr_registered_city_name'] = $this->area_obj->findCityNameByCode1($row['sr_registered_city_code']);
$province_id = $row['sr_province_id'];
$city_id = $row['sr_city_id'];
$third_id = $row['sr_category_code'];
$second_id = $thirdInfo->Spid;
$first_id = $thirdInfo->Fpid;
} else {
$province_id = 0;
$city_id = 0;
$third_id = 0;
$second_id = 0;
$first_id = 0;
}
$this->output['third_id'] = $third_id;
$this->output['second_id'] = $second_id;
$this->output['first_id'] = $first_id;
$this->output['province_id'] = $province_id;
$this->output['city_id'] = $city_id;
$this->output['row_info'] = $row;
$this->displaySmarty('dydqtshoppc/register/register.html');